Unlike when I was growing up, fresh fruit is in the grocery stores all year around, but one thing hasn't changed: seasonal fruit always has a better price because it is plentiful.   Like apples in the Fall are cheaper,  peaches, watermelons and cantaloupes in the summer, and all kinds of berries in the spring and early summer.   I love that Strawberries are beginning to make a big appearance here in the grocery stores, which means the prices will start to go down.

German Chocolate Cake Balls are just another addition to my long list of German Chocolate favorites.   If you have not made cake balls before, this recipe is a good one to start with.  Typically, you can make them with cake mixes, canned frosting, and dipping chocolate.   How easy is that?  Only 3 ingredients!
